Neuroendocrine heart and hypothalamus
Authors:Armen Galoyan
Institution:(1) Institute of Biochemistry, Sevag str. 5/1, 375044 Yerevan, USSR
Abstract:Data on the endocrine heart—neurosecretory cells of heart, producing coronarydilatory, metabolically active glycopeptides with physico-chemical and biological properties similar to those of previously discovered cardioactive hypothalamic neurohormones—are summarized. Heart hormones participate in both local and distant regulation of heart metabolism and function. Formation and action of these heart hormones is closely related to hypothalamic cardioactive neurohormones K, C, and G and their protein precursors. Neurohormones from heart and hypothalamus comprise a system of neurohumoral connections between these two organs.
